Q: Is 7,512,430 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,512,430 is a composite number.

Why is 7,512,430 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,512,430 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 41 73 82 146 205 251 365 410 502 730 1,255 2,510 2,993 5,986 10,291 14,965 18,323 20,582 29,930 36,646 51,455 91,615 102,910 183,230 751,243 1,502,486 3,756,215 and 7,512,430, with no remainder.

Since 7,512,430 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,512,430, it is a composite number.
